Rob Werlinger, launching under the newly developed alias SATION, is an emerging artist set to debut in 2026 with a sound rooted in organic, analog-driven tech house. With no prior brand infrastructure in place, the project presented a rare opportunity to build an artist identity from the ground up — one that could support not just initial releases, but long-term creative evolution across music, visuals, and live performance. Seeking to establish a distinctive and future-ready presence, Rob partnered with A World Away to define every aspect of SATION’s world before its introduction to market.
A World Away led the full development of the SATION identity, beginning with the creation of the name itself — a concept designed to evoke motion, perception, and emotional depth. From there, we executed a complete brand and identity system, including logo development, typography direction, visual language, and a comprehensive brand guideline that would serve as the foundation for all future creative output. To bring the identity into the physical world, we directed and produced a cinematic press shoot in Los Angeles, capturing imagery that reflected the project’s analog textures and atmospheric tone. Alongside this, we developed release creative and collateral for SATION’s debut records, ensuring a cohesive visual rollout across streaming platforms, social media, and press.
The result is a fully realized artist ecosystem — one that positions SATION not simply as a new act, but as a considered and intentional creative project. Through strategic world-building, visual storytelling, and disciplined brand execution, A World Away transformed an early-stage concept into a scalable identity designed to evolve with every release, performance, and audience interaction to come.
